بسم الله الرحمن الرحيم
السلام عليكم ورحمة الله وبركاته
كيف كان أول وثاني أيام العيد أما بعد أشكرك على هذا البرنامج والى الامام دوماً أنشاء الله
أخاك إبراهيم
|
|
بسم الله الرحمن الرحيم
أريد أن أقول أن أحجية خوارزمية قدنالت أعجابي بالفعل وأقول لك شكراً على هذا البرنامج الرائع
وشكراً
M.A
شفيء حبار ( موسى )
|
|
وعليكم السلام ورحمة الله وبركاته،
حملت الحزمة وسأطلع على البرنامج في أقرب وقت (هذا لا يعني في وقت قريب) وأي ملاحظات، تحسينات ... سأبلغك بها.
في أمان الله.
|
|
وعليكم السلام، إبراهيم. العيد جميلٌ لأنه عيد. إن شاء الله أنت أيضًا لا تتوقف عن التعمق في الحاسوب. (بالمناسبة: "أنشاء الله" خطأ، الصحيح "إن شاء الله" + يفضل أن تصغر حجم الخط)
شكرًا موسى على مساندتك التي لا غنى عنها. وفقك الله. (يفضل أن تصغر حجم الخط)
مرحبًا، يعقوب.
بالتأكيد في الانتظار...
|
|
و عليكم السلام و رحمة الله و بركاته ,,
ماشاء الله تبارك الرحمن أخي غسان ,,
لم أستطع المرور هكذا بدون رد بالرغم من أني
لا أعرف كثيرا في لغات و دواخل الحواسيب لكني أتعلم و قد أشرت بالكتاب لأخي فهو يعرفها قليلا ,,
اعذرني لعدم مناقشتي كثيرا في الموضوع ,, لكننا حقا نفخر بعملك و جهدك ,,
أقدر عشقك ل++C ,, فأنا عشقي الكيمياء ,,
بوركت أخي ووفقك الله في دراستك ,,
تابع جهدك و عملك فحتما ستصل إلى القمة ,,(:
معذرة أشعر أن كلماتي مبعثرة ,, ^^"
في حفظ المولى ~ْ
|
|
السـلام عليكم ورحمة الله وبركاته...
حملت البرنــامج وفعلاً أشتغل الملف...
وهذا المهم الكتيب أشتغل...
لكن العجيب أن ملف نهايته cpp لم يشتغل وربمــا نقص عندي في البرامج...
المهم أن الكتيب أشتغل...
وبقراءه إن شــاء الله...
شــاهدت الفيديو وإن شــاء الله أفهم لمن أقراء...
مشكور على الرد...
الله يعطيك العااافية...
|
|
الملف ذو اللاحقة cpp والتي تعني C Plus Plus هو الملف المصدري (الوصفة) الأصلية التي تبنى بها البرامج. وبما أنني رخصت البرنامج تحت GNU/GPLv3 توجب علي أن أمكن المستخدمين من الوصول إلى الملف المصدري والذي لا ينشر في العادة.
إن لم تكوني مهتمة في البرمجة، فلا تلقي بالاً لذلك الملف.
السلام عليكم ورحمة الله وبركاته ..
رغم عدم فهمي جيداً بما قمت به، لكن أعرف أن مجهودكـ مذهل !!
وبالتأكيد سأقرأ كل حرف كتبته في ملف الشرحـ، لأنني أشعر أنني سأستفيد منه يوماً ما
انا من الصف العاشر، وأول سنه نتعامل مع لغة البرمجه!
ومرَّ عليّ لغة الـ++C كذكر فقط أنه من الـ High level language !
ولكن نتعامل الآن مع برنامج الفيجوال بيسكـ من لغات المستوى العالي أيضاً ! تعملت منه الكثير
وبقي الكثير من الخفايا من زلنا نتعلمها ! والأستاذ يضل يقلنا يفيدكم في الـIT بالجامعه !
همم ,, بصراحة لا أطمح لدراسة الآي تي لأنها من أعلى المعدلات بفلسطين ! ولا أريد أن أتأمل أن بإستطاعتي الحصول على معدل يؤهلني لدراسة هذا الشيء
ولكن أود أتعرف على أحجية ليس أملاً لدخول هذه الكلية ! بل حباً لهذه الأشياء =) !
وإن شاء الله سيكون انت من سيعرفني على هذا البرنامج، وسيكون لي عودة إن شاء بعد انتهائي من القراءة !
عذراً لخروجي قليلاً عن الموضوع
جزاكـ الله ألف خير أخوي ,,
|
|
وعليكم السلام. عيدًا مباركًا للجميع. لا، بل أعذريني أنا لإزعاجك بالرسائل الخاصة.
وفقك الله.
مرحبًا عبد الرحمن. أرجو أن تكون بتمام الصحة والعافية.
مبدع؟ أظنني جد مبتدئ حتى يطلق علي هذا اللقب. شكرًا جزيلاً لك.
بالمناسبة، عن خبرة مباشرة مني واحتكاكي مع بعض الأجانب، أيقنت أن التفكير السائد لدينا بأن الغرب ينتقصنا ملفق.
صحيح، هم يكونون فكرة عنا بأن التعليم عندنا ضعيف، والمشاكل كلها فوق رؤوسنا. لكنني عندما كنت أناقش بعض الفرنسيين في البرمجة والحاسوب، ومع علمهم بأنني عربي من اليمن، كانوا يعطوني الفرصة لأتكلم وأقول ما لدي، وكنا نتناقش ندًا لند. فلم أشعر حقيقة بذلك الشعور الذي كان يروج له أساتذتي في الثانوية من أن الأجانب ينتقصوننا ويروننا متخلفين.
في الأخير توصلت بأنهم يكونون فكرة مسبقة عنا، ولكنهم في نفس الوقت لا يستهينوا بك من أول نظرة.
وفقك الله في اختباراتك.
أهلاً وسهلاً.
ما شاء الله في الصف العاشر وتتعلمون برمجة؟! (في اليمن نتعلم على الحاسوب من مقاهي الإنترنت)
قد يبدو في البداية معقدًا، ولكنك متى قرأته ستفهمه، وحتى إن لم تفهمه فلا يجب عليك ذلك في ليلة وضحاها. (لي عام كامل أتعلم الـ ++C. فلم أصل إلى هذه المرحلة في غمضة عين)
وفقك الله في دراستك. وأي مساعدة سنكون حاضرين متى استطعنا إن شاء الله.
في أمان الله.
|
|
وعليكم السلام ورحمة الله وبركاته
عيداً سعيداً وان شاء الله تتحقق كل اماني الخير ^_^
بصراحة اخي برنامجك ملفت للنظر فلم ارى برنامج عربي يهتم بامور التشفير
اسلوب البرنامج جميل و بسيط و قوي
لقد جربت البرنامج على نظام ويندوز سيفن 64 بت وعند عملية التشفير وبالتحديد بعد كتابة الباسورد وضغط زر انتر ظهرة رسالة خطأ وتم اغلاق نافذة البرنامج السوداء !!!
لم اعلم سبب الخطأ !!!
ولدي بعض الملاحظات البسيطة :
1- استعمال البرنامج بسيط حتى بدون واجهة رسومية ولكن لا بد من صنع واجهة رسومية فهذا شيء اساسي خاصة لمستخدمي ويندوز فهم لم يعتادو على استخدام الـ CMD, وبغض النظر عن هذا الامر فالواجهة الرسومية تختصر الوقت بكتابة الاوامر بالاضافة الى انها تعطي انطباع جميل عن البرنامج خاصة اذا كانت ذات تصميم انيق وبسيط, وتأكد ان اخوانك في منتدى مسومس من مصممين يتشوقون الى مساعدتك ^_^ ...
2- حسب ما فهمة من ان البرنامج يشفر "أسكي" فقط فهذا يعني انه لان يشفر اي ملف باي لغة اخرى كالعربية واليابانية وهذه نقطة ضعف من وجهة نظري فالبرنامج يجب ان يشمل تعدد اللغات ...
3- وبالنسبة لنقطة استعمال لغة الرسائل القصيرة فهي فكرة جميلة حيث ان تلك اللغة تعتبر تشفير بحد ذاتها حيث تدمج بين لغة الحروف ولغة الارقام والرموز, ولكن سيكون استخدامها لمن لم يعتد استخدامها امر متعب ...
4- بالنسبة لضعف تشفير الملفات الصغيرة فلدي فكرة لجعلها اقوى ولكن من الان اقول لك لا افقه شيء لحد الان بلغات البرمجة وفكرتي تستطيع ان تقول انها من طفل بالكاد بدء يقرء ولكن قلت اخبرك بها ربما توحي لك بشيء ما, الفكرة كالتالي وهو ان تضيف رموز وهمية تنتجها عملية التشفير وبذلك سيكون الملف الصغير بقوة الملف الكبير, ولكن الجانب السلبي من هذه العملية ازدياد حجم البيانات بسبب البيانات الوهمية, ويفضل هنا ان تدع الخيار للمستخدم حيث تصنع خيار بالبرنامج لنوعي التشفير حيث النوع الاول تشفير ضعيف بحجم صغير والنوع الثاني تشفير قوي بحجم كبير, علماً ان البرنامج الذي سيتمكن من فك تشفير الصغير غالباً سيتمكن من فك تشفير الكبير ولكن بوقت اكثر ...
5- هناك بعض الاخطأ الاملائية البسيطة في الكتاب الالكتروني الخاص باللغة العربية لذلك مستقبلاً يفضل عمل تدقيق لغوي للملف قبل نشره ...
سؤال فضولي ولك الحرية بعدم الاجابة :
ما هو تخصصك بالضبط بالكلية وباي مرحلة انت ؟؟؟
هل تفكر بتعلم لغة الـ C ام ستكتفي بالـ ++C ؟؟؟
عذراً على الاطالة واتمنى ان يستمر تطوير البرنامج ليشمل جميع انواع الملفات بالاضافة الى القوة بالتشفير ...
وايضاً عليك مشاهدة البرامج المشابهة لفكرة هذا البرنامج لتأخذ منها الافكار وتتلافا الاخطأ التي فيها ...
وشكراً لك وبارك الله بك وجزاك خيراً ووفقك لما يحب ويرضى ...
اخوك من عوالم التقنيات سيد الظلال ...
والسلام عليكم ورحمة الله وبركاته
|
|
مرحبًا بك أخي الكريم.
هل البرنامج يعلق معك في تلك النقطة دائمًا (إدخال الباسورد)؟
---
1- بالنسبة للواجهة الرسومية فأنا مخطط لذلك، إلا أنها ليست بتلك البساطة. فلغة الـ ++C لا تدعم الواجهات كالبيسك والجافا والشارب، ولكن توجد مكتبات تمكن من ذلك مثل Qt و wxWidgets. إن شاء الله سأتعلم Qt بعد إنتهائي من أحجية نهاية هذه السنة الميلادية. (إن كانت لدى أحد المقدرة على صنع واجهة رسومية لغة أخرى وربطها بأحجية فسأقدر ذلك جدًا!)
2- نفس السابق، لأتمكن من اللغات العديدة فإنني سأحتاج إلى استخدام مكتبة Qt. إن شاء الله مستقبلاً.
4- فكرة جيدة، لكن كيف أستطيع أن أعرف أي البيانات الوهمية وأيها الأصلي عند فك التشفير. سأحاول التفكير فيها إن شاء الله.
5- إن شاء الله سأدقق أكثر المرة القادمة.
-----
شكرًا على مشاركتك الفعالة فأنا أحب النقاشات العلمية. كما لا تتردد في وضع أي ملاحظات في نفس هذا الموضوع.
|
|
1- أنا درست في اليمن سنة أولى، ولكنني عندما سافرت إلى ماليزيا للدراسة قررت أن أبدأ من جديد، حيث أنهم يدرسون الجافا، ولست أحبها كثيرًا فقلت أخذ السنة الأولى لكي تكون الدراسة خفيفة علي، وأتعلم لي الـ ++C بنفسي.سؤال فضولي ولك الحرية بعدم الاجابة :
ما هو تخصصك بالضبط بالكلية وباي مرحلة انت ؟؟؟
هل تفكر بتعلم لغة الـ C ام ستكتفي بالـ ++C ؟؟؟
إن شاء الله سأتخصص برمجة هواتف نقالة.
2- لا، لا نية لي في الـ C. أريد أن أتوسع في الـ ++C لأنها بالنسبة لي العشيقة الأولى وتوفر لي تحكم رهيب في البرامج وبدأت أفهم تفكيرها.
|
|
اشكر لك اخي سرعة اجابتك ودقتها ...
اما بالنسبة لمشكلة الخطأ بعد ادخال الباسورد فهي ظهرة لي مرة واحدة من اصل ثلاثة, اي جربة عملية الفك والضغط ثلاثة مرات وظهرة المشكلة بالمرة الاولى فقط !!!
بالنسبة للتمييز بين البيانات الوهمية والحقيقية فهناك طريقة وهي ان تكون البيانات الوهمية برموز لا يمكن ان تأتي بالبيانات الحقيقية مثلاً رمز 1 حقيقي ولكن بالوهمي يوجد رمز 1;; وهذا لا يوجد بالحقيقي وبهكذا طريقة تعد البرنامج ليفصل بين الوهمي والحقيقي على اساس قاعدة بيانات مختلفة لكل واحدة منهما, وكما قلت لك هذه فكرة بسيطة فعذراً ان لم تكن ذات فائدة لعدم امتلكي معلومات بهذا المجال لحد الان ...
واتمنى لك كل الموفقية واستودعك في حفظ الرحمن ...
|
|
صحيح، التمييز سينفع، لكن كثرتها سيؤدي ذلك إلى ضعف التشفير، حيث أذا صمم أحدهم برنامج ليعمل كلمات مرور عشوائية وتفحص الناتج واحتكشف وجود كثير من البيانات الوهمبة فإن ذلك سيسهل له الخطى، فسيجعل البرنامج يلف بحيث كل مرة يغير رقم واحد من كلمة المرور ولم يتكشف بينات وهمية، ثبت الرقم وانتقل إلى الذي بعده.
قد أكون أنا الآن أفكر بطريقة مختلفة، وقد تكون فكرتك رهيبة. لكنها بالتأكيد تحتاج لبعض العمليات الحسابية.
لا تستهين أبدًا بأي فكرة تخطر في ذهنك. فكل البرامج العملاقة تبدأ بفكرة بسيطة جدًا، راجع تاريخ الفوتوشوب مثلاً.
أذكر عندما أخبرت صديقي بهذا البرنامج قبل خمسة أشهر، قلي بطل تضييع وقت وركز على الإختبارات. لكن يجب على كل واحد منا أن يثق بقدراته ويتوكل على الله.
كما أن أحجية مفتوح المصدر، افعل به ما تشاء، لكن عندما تصدره يجب تشير أنه معدل.
دمت في أمان الله.
|
|
من الاسم عرفت انك يمني اهلا بكومع علمهم بأنني عربي من اليمن
لا اخي هذا زمان على ايامي وايامكفي اليمن نتعلم على الحاسوب من مقاهي الإنترنت
الان لها اقسام خاصة في الجامعات وفي المدارس والثانويات وحتى في بالجامعه بقسم التربية قسم خاص بالحاسوب
>>>>> لسنا في صلب الموضوع بس اخي احببت اصحح الصورة
|
|
|
|
حجز
لــي عوده بعــد القراءة
|
|
السـلام عليكم ورحمة الله وبركاته...
الحمدلله قرأت الكتيب واتضحت أمور أجهلهــا...
مع إني أعترف أن في كثير خفايــا و أمور صعبة التعامل معهـا...
ولغة الأرقــام صعبة ذكرتني بالرياضيات.....
بس الحمدلله المهم إني أخذت فوائد....
عندي سؤال ماهو التشفير وأي ملفات تشفر؟...
وهل لغة واحدة وهي الإنجليزي الوحيدة اللي تشفر؟
ما الفائدة من التشفير؟...
أسئلة غبية جاوبت عليهــا بس يمكن إجابتي غير مهمة وخاصة إني أجهل هذا العلم....
الله يعطيك العااافية...
|
|
أولا دعني اقدم لك جزيل الشكر و التقدير على الجهدالمبذول في هذه الاحجية
ثانيا كل مرة أجد فيها أحد المبرمجين يبرمجون تلك الحروف العجيبة والارقام الكثيرة
يزداد أعجاب بهم أكثر فأكثر لا أعرف عن البرمجة شيء ولكنك جعلتني أقوم بتلك الخطوة التي لطالما
أردت الهرب منها لصعوبتها
فلأجرب فهم البرمجة
وجاري التحميل و الفهم
^_^
المفضلات